MLC says Millennials are first generational to be less well off than their parents
A Tynwald member and demographer fears young people are stuck renting because of changes to intergenerational wealth.
Paul Craine, who's recently published an updated study of the Island's population, has been discussing the challenges younger generations face getting on the property ladder.
The MLC says data shows Millennials are the first generation to be less well off than their parents.
